Sugarcane belongs to the family Poaceae and Kentucky Bluegrass belongs to the family Poaceae.

Also, when you compare Sugarcane and Kentucky Bluegrass,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Saccharum and other plant's genus is Poa. Sugarcane tribe is Andropogoneae and Kentucky Bluegrass tribe is Poeae. Sugarcane clade is Commelinids and Monocots and order is Cyperales whereas Kentucky Bluegrass clade is Angiosperms, Commelinids and Monocots and order is Cyperales. Every plant have subfamilies. Sugarcane subfamilies are, Panicoideae and Kentucky Bluegrass subfamilies are Pooideae.
